From 36f611b7c1a71f388892a91527ad5e2af7594c49 Mon Sep 17 00:00:00 2001 From: Corban-Lee Jones Date: Sun, 4 Aug 2024 20:13:29 +0100 Subject: [PATCH] Update docker-build.yaml --- .gitea/workflows/docker-build.yaml | 14 +++++++++++--- 1 file changed, 11 insertions(+), 3 deletions(-) diff --git a/.gitea/workflows/docker-build.yaml b/.gitea/workflows/docker-build.yaml index 71a1c99..3c2035f 100644 --- a/.gitea/workflows/docker-build.yaml +++ b/.gitea/workflows/docker-build.yaml @@ -25,17 +25,25 @@ jobs: git config --global user.name "${{ secrets.GIT_USERNAME }}" - name: Bump version + id: bump_version run: | bump2version patch + NEW_VERSION=$(git describe --tags) + echo ${NEW_VERSION} + echo "NEW_VERSION=${NEW_VERSION}" > new_version.txt - name: Build Docker image run: | - docker build -t pyrss-website:${{ steps.bump-version.outputs.new_version }} . + NEW_VERSION=$(cat new_version.txt) + docker build -t pyrss-website:${{ NEW_VERSION }} . - name: Push Docker image run: | - docker tag pyrss-website:${{ steps.bump-version.outputs.new_version }} xordk/pyrss-website:${{ steps.bump-version.outputs.new_version }} - docker push xordk/pyrss-website:${{ steps.bump-version.outputs.new_version }} + NEW_VERSION=$(cat new_version.txt) + docker tag pyrss-website:${{ NEW_VERSION }} xordk/pyrss-website:${{ NEW_VERSION }} + docker push xordk/pyrss-website:${{ NEW_VERSION }} + rm new_version.txt + env: DOCKER_PASSWORD: ${{ secrets.DOCKER_PASSWORD }} DOCKER_USERNAME: ${{ secrets.DOCKER_USERNAME }} \ No newline at end of file